1. What Does "Opening Both Ways" Mean?

When people ask if bifold doors can open both ways, they usually mean either:

  • Split Opening: Panels fold to both the left and right sides
  • Dual-Access: Two traffic doors on opposite ends for multiple entry points

Both options are possible — depending on the number of panels and the specific system design.


2. Split Opening Configurations

A common solution for wider openings is the split-stack configuration, such as a 6-panel bifold that folds 3 to the left and 3 to the right. This creates:

  • Symmetry in the design
  • Balance in the opening
  • Flexible access depending on the flow of your space

Cortizo bifold systems can be custom-designed to support this layout, with precise engineering for smooth movement and secure stacking.


3. Multiple Traffic Doors for Dual Access

In some cases, homeowners want independent access from both ends of the bifold system — for example, one door near the kitchen and another near the living room. This can be achieved by integrating multiple traffic doors into the configuration.

Cortizo’s systems allow for this level of customisation, offering easy access without having to fold all the panels open each time.


4. Considerations for Both-Way Openings

While bifold doors can open both ways, a few things should be considered:

  • Space availability for panel stacking on both sides
  • Symmetry with existing architecture
  • Desired flow between indoor and outdoor spaces
